Just a quick note on cleaning. Once in a while when the copper gets a little
too messy for my tastes, I use that cheap old cleaning agent for copper: a
mixture of vinegar and salt. I keep an old dishwashing liquid bottle full of
it under the kitchen sink. I don't remember the proportions off hand, but
really doesn't matter that much. I tend use it when the outside of the pot
gets a "clean streak" down the side from dripping contents, as many food
items will "clean" the copper just as well as the vinegar/salt mixture. I
also use it to clean out my zabaglione pan before use since it is unlined.
